armdeveloper wrote:
> So in gschem, what component would I use ?
Take a generic R and maybe add some label to it about which pins it
represents, or not... then copy 7 times and change the pinname and
pinnumber attribs by editing the symbol in gschem...
What footprint would I give
> it ?
Make one from the Bourns datasheet.
How do I identify which resistor of the component ? (Use the slot
> attribute ?)
Yes, use gattrib on your schematic with the eight generic R's
to add slot=a for pins 1,2 slot=b for pins 3,4, etc.
